Town to town, up and down the dial…Mark Evanier has some thoughts about Air America Radio, which gives me a chance to piggyback and add my own.

I agree with a lot of what Mark has to say here. Judging the hosts that I have heard as broadcasters, apart from whether I agree with them, Al Franken clearly comes out on top. I suspect he’s helped by his co-host Katherine Lanpher, but he’s also got a voice that works for radio, one not a million miles from Stan Freberg…who he also physically resembles. And who he’s next to on my bookshelf. And who he admires, according to the NYT Magazine story a few weeks back.

But I digress.

And yes, Randi Rhodes is awful–like a horrible, strident parody of a feminist.

As for Janeane Garofalo, I’ve gone back and forth on her over the years. I used to really like her, especially around 96/97, when The Truth About Cats and Dogs and Romy & Michelle’s High School Reunion came out. Funny, smart woman, hello! And I still quote one of her stand-up comedy lines–the imitation of every movie trailer ever made: “In a world…”

But there came a time when I began to get sick of the entire “Ben Stiller Mafia” as I like to call it.

More recently I’ve been known to accuse her of trying to rebuild a career as a liberal commentator because she has no new material as a comedian and no one is offering her movies any more.

All that said, the worst I can say about her Air America show is that she doesn’t have a voice that works for radio. I think a lot of her appeal as a performer comes from her gestures and facial expressions, stripped of these, she doesn’t connect as hard as she might.
